 Liberia - Prince Yormie Johnson and the Independant Patriotic Front (IPF)
Johnson originally was allied to Taylor when he first attacked Doe in 1989.
Johnson and Taylor both claimed the presidency and set off another round of bloodshed.
The fighting lasted seven weeks between the rival factions and as it raged Johnson was flown by U.S. Marines to Accra, Ghana to attend peace talks.

 A Brief Review of the Liberian War Between 1989 and 2004   (Site not responding. Last check: 2007-11-03)
On September 9, 1990, Doe was shot and captured at the Freeport of Monrovia, then taken to the Taylor Major compound in Caldwell, outside Monrovia, where his captors murdered him and mutilated his body.
His captors?Rebel Prince Yedou Johnson and his fellow Nimba fighters of the Independent National Patriotic Front of Liberia (INPFL), who earlier broke away from Charles Taylor's deadly National Patriotic Front of Liberia.
Doe was meeting with the Force Commander, Ghana's Arnold Quinoo, at the Freeport of Monrovia, when Prince Johnson walked in there.
